Killer hospital superbug infected 65 patients

Another 15 patients were infected by a killer superbug at Auckland hospital last month, bringing the total number of cases to 65.

Hospital spokeswoman Jessamy Malcolm said 17 patients were being closely watched but the vancomycin-resistant enterococci (VRE) outbreak had been contained.

"We have ongoing screening of all new admissions to adult services," she said. "Once we have permanently stabilised VRE we will go to active surveillance in high-risk groups."
